Nah, you're just buying the wrong brand. If you see lower case 'pyrex', this is not borosilicate glass.

You can still buy 'PYREX' (uppercase) which is borosilicate glass.

Building renewables doesn't change the energy bill for anyone because electricity price is pegged to the cost of gas.

Which there are good reasons for, arguably, but it means you could triple the amount of solar panels in the UK and your bill won't change an iota.
